IEC 60068-2-13:2021 specifies methods of test applicable to specimens which, during transportation, storage or in service, can be subjected to low air pressure. This fifth edition cancels and replaces the fourth edition, published in 1983. This edition constitutes a technical revision. This edition includes the following significant technical changes with respect to the previous edition: a) alignment with recently revised parts of IEC 60068-2; b) Clause 5: severities aligned with IEC 60721-2-3 and IEC 60721-3 (all parts); c) addition of Annex A (guidance on selecting the duration of exposure).

Overview
IEC 60068-2-13:2021, published by the International Electrotechnical Commission (IEC), specifies standardized test methods to evaluate the ability of equipment, components, and other specimens to withstand low air pressure conditions experienced during transportation, storage, or use. Commonly known as Test M: Low air pressure, this standard is essential for manufacturers and industries whose products may be exposed to high-altitude or low-pressure environments. The 2021 edition includes technical updates for improved alignment with related IEC environmental testing standards and introduces new guidance for determining test durations.
Key Topics
- Low Air Pressure Testing: Procedures for subjecting specimens to reduced atmospheric pressure to simulate environmental conditions at high altitudes.
- Test Severities and Parameters: Recommendations for air pressure values and durations, referencing established altitude-pressure relationships.
- Test Apparatus Requirements: Chamber specifications to ensure stable and accurate low-pressure conditions during the test.
- Preconditioning and Measurements:
- Steps to visually inspect and electrically or mechanically check specimens before and after testing.
- Preconditioning guidance if required by the relevant product specification.
- Test Process:
- Pressure reduction and maintenance at specified values.
- Conditioning duration, with recommended time intervals (5 min, 30 min, 2 h, 4 h, 16 h).
- Recovery procedures following exposure.
- Reporting Requirements: Essential data and observations to include in comprehensive test reports, ensuring repeatability and transparency.
Applications
IEC 60068-2-13:2021 is widely applicable across multiple industries, including electronics, telecommunications, aerospace, automotive, and defense, where products must perform reliably under varying atmospheric pressures. Practical scenarios include:
- Aviation and Aerospace Equipment: Ensuring reliability of components exposed to very low air pressure at high altitudes.
- Transport and Storage: Testing packaging and devices for safe shipment via air freight or in mountainous regions.
- Outdoor and Remote Installations: Validates performance of field equipment installed at significant elevations.
- Defense & Military Applications: Certifying devices for use in varying altitude environments.
The test helps identify potential issues such as material deformation, seal failures, performance degradation, or other vulnerabilities that may only appear under low-pressure conditions.
